As Christians we are called to, The life of Freedom, to run with Jesus in freedom.
So Paul reminds them and us of the power we, as Christians, live in because of Jesus in verse 1:
Christ has set us free,
Free from the power of sin and satan. From the need to obey rules and laws to save us. This is the power of Jesus and the depth of God love.
We see the encouragement to:
Stand firm in our freedom.
As Jesus said after the magnificent sermon on the mount.
Matthew 7:24 “Therefore everyone who hears these words of mine and puts them into practice is like a wise man who built his house on the rock.
The only way we can stand firm is to have confidence that we are standing on the rock of Jesus and his teachings.
And then we see the challenge:
Do not submit to the yoke of slavery
This is Paul’s desperate plea to the Galatians and to us.
Don’t fall back, don’t allow yourself to be hindered, don’t get distracted
As I say all of this I’m aware that many of us may think, freedom, with all that’s going on in my life, we all have issues Many may say I would love this freedom, BUT!
Come to Jesus
When Paul is speaking of the power of the slavery he uses the word Yoke. That wooden device that was put around an ox to pull the plough.
Jesus speaks about his Yoke
Matthew 11:28 “Come to me, all you who are weary and burdened, and I will give you rest. 29 Take my yoke upon you and learn from me, for I am gentle and humble in heart, and you will find rest for your souls. 30 For my yoke is easy and my burden is light.”
In Jesus we find rest and the power to live in freedom, as we come to him weary and burdened.
Learn from Jesus:
The Christian life is all about Jesus, not about the things we do that we think will give us a good a standing in God’s eyes, as the enemies of Paul were trying to say.
As we continue on we see Paul gives us some contrasts, of the life of freedom and slavery.
Basically saying in verse 2-4 if you accept doing things in your own power then Christ is of no advantage to you, you are a slave, severed from Christ. You have lost the power of meaning of GRACE. Grace the powerful expression of God’s love and acceptance of us.
Which as we see in verse 5 the stark contrast to living the life of freedom.
5 For through the Spirit, by faith, we ourselves eagerly wait for the hope of righteousness.
The Life of Freedom
•Is lived through the Spirit
As we read in John 14-16
The gifts of the spirit, build up the body and we show the fruit of the spirit.
•By Faith
Trusting in Jesus takes the burden off our shoulders.
•Eagerly awaiting the hope of righteousness
Actively waiting living a life of hope now and in the future when Jesus will judge and his righteousness will cover us.
This is the life of freedom!
We see more in verse 6:
6 For in Christ Jesus neither circumcision nor uncircumcision counts for anything, but only faith working through love.
•Is a life faith working through love
As we continue on in verse 7 we see
That a life of freedom
•Is always aware of what can hinder their freedom
•Understands that even a little disobedience effects everything
9 A little leaven leavens the whole lump.
What is your leaven?
•Understands that obedience costs
11 But if I, brothers, still preach circumcision, why am I still being persecuted?
Look at Jesus
This is what he was doing on the earth. Helping people to see the burdens the religious establishment had put on the people. Teaching to obey God, taking the cost, but bringing hope and love.
As Paul finishes this section he returns to love in verse 13.
13 For you were called to freedom, brothers. Only do not use your freedom as an opportunity for the flesh, but through love serve one another.
•Is not about self
14 For the whole law is fulfilled in one word: “You shall love your neighbor as yourself.”
•Through love serves one another
Look at Jesus’ love .
Love one another, this next weeks and months will be tough as the cost of living increases let us support and seek support.
Finally note the warning in verse 15
If you are in slavery you will be like this.
15 But if you bite and devour one another, watch out that you are not consumed by one another.
Let us live the life of freedom.
